SimSpace is looking for a Senior Software Engineer - Backend to join our team. This role is responsible for backend development and will drive platform-related work in areas like authorization, user management, and organization management in a microservices environment.

Responsibilities

WHAT WILL YOU BE DOING AS A SENIOR SOFTWARE ENGINEER - BACK END AT SIMSPACE?

  • Develop and design core services as part of a distributed application for the construction and simulation of cybersecurity ranges
  • Help lead our team through challenging technical projects
  • Collaborate with other engineers, UX designers, and product managers
  • Help the team improve in culture, coding best practices, and systems architecture
  • Support and mentor other engineers

WHAT ARE THE QUALIFICATIONS TO APPLY? TO BE SUCCESSFUL IN THIS ROLE, YOU’LL NEED TO:

  • Have production experience developing and operating services at scale
  • Be proficient with API Design
  • Be proficient with the principles of testing software
  • Have familiarity with Kubernetes
  • Have experience developing fault-tolerant systems from the ground up, including requirements-gathering, architecture design, project breakdown, and execution
  • Feel comfortable leading, driving, and delegating team initiatives
  • Enjoy solving complex problems & building solutions through collaborative methods
  • Always open for feedback, and are willing to give feedback to your colleagues
  • Understand that nothing is perfect and there is always room for improvement
  • Are driven by goals and team outcomes
  • Focus on the iterative delivery of high-quality well tested code
  • Be conscious of scalability and reusability, but also pragmatic when it comes to trade-offs
